This sketch works with ServoFirmata running on Arduino
import processing.serial.*;
import cc.arduino.*;
import ddf.minim.*;
Arduino arduino;
Minim minim;
AudioInput in;
color red;
color green;
color blue;
float RMS;
int servo1 = 9;
void setup() {
println(Arduino.list());
arduino = new Arduino(this, Arduino.list()[2], 57600);
for (int i = 0; i <= 13; i++)
arduino.pinMode(i, Arduino.OUTPUT);
size(512, 400, P2D);
red = color(255, 100, 100);
blue = color(100, 100, 255);
green = color(100, 255, 100);
minim = new Minim(this);
minim.debugOn();
// get a line in from Minim, default bit depth is 16
in = minim.getLineIn(Minim.STEREO, 512);
background(0);
}
void draw() {
background(0);
strokeWeight(1); // Normal
// draw the waveforms
for (int i = 0; i < in.bufferSize() - 1; i++)
{
stroke(green);
line(i, 50 + in.left.get(i)*50, i+1, 50 + in.left.get(i+1)*50);
stroke(blue);
line(i, 150 + in.right.get(i)*50, i+1, 150 + in.right.get(i+1)*50);
RMS = abs(in.left.get(i)) + abs(in.right.get(i));
}
strokeWeight(10); // Coarse
stroke(red);
line ( 0, 300, RMS*300, 300);
int servoAngle = (int)map(RMS, 0, 1, 10, 170);
arduino.analogWrite(servo1, servoAngle);
strokeWeight(1); // Coarse
}
void stop()
{
// always close Minim audio classes when you are done with them
in.close();
minim.stop();
super.stop();
}
